Do you wash an ace bandage? Keep the bandage clean between uses. Wash it by hand in warm soapy water. Then rinse it, and let it air dry.
Is it OK to leave an Ace bandage on overnight? NEVER LEAVE AN ELASTIC BANDAGE ON OVERNIGHT. Elevation by raising the injured area above the level of the heart also assists in reducing swelling often associated with injury.
How long can you leave an Ace bandage on? You should apply a compression bandage as soon as a sprain occurs. Wrap your ankle with an elastic bandage, such as an ACE bandage, and leave it on for 48 to 72 hours.
Are ace wraps reusable? Yes. ACE bandages are made of high quality and can easily be washed and reused. … I usually wash them in cold water and on delicate.

What cycle to wash sneakers?
Using liquid detergent, run the washer on a cold delicate cycle. Depending on your washer, the wash time varies from 30 to 40 minutes. Remove the sneakers from the washer and allow them to air dry. NEVER put shoes in the dryer, as the heat may warp them or damage the glue that keeps them together.

Can you stack a washer and dryer on one pedestal?
Pedestals are made for front-load washers and dryers. Top-load washers and dryers will be more difficult to unload with the added height of a pedestal. Only use pedestals for side-by-side washer and dryer installations. You cannot use a pedestal to stack a washer and dryer.
How to do a paint wash on wood?
Start by adding one part water to two parts paint, and test the wash on a wooden swatch before working directly on your surface. If you want to see more wood grain, continue to add water. You’ll notice that as the wash gets lighter, the tone of the wood’s original color comes through.
